Regular face cleansing is the basis of maintaining clear skin. Over time, pores collect grime, sebum, and bacteria, which, if not removed, may cause blemishes, dullness, and other concerns. Proper washing gets rid of these residues, ensuring a clean facial area. That being said, it’s important to apply a non-irritating face wash appropriate for your specific skin needs to prevent over-drying. Using harsh cleansers can deplete essential moisture, resulting in flakiness. Those with delicate skin benefit from fragrance-free products. Those with excess sebum may prefer oil-controlling products that deeply clean without overcompensating. Hydrating cream-based products are ideal for parched complexions, providing softness without tightness.
After washing, hydration is a must in any skincare routine. Facial creams work to restore moisture, stopping dryness or sensitivity. Every skin type, moisturization is beneficial. Pure oils are highly recommended for their ability to deeply nourish. Unlike conventional moisturizers, beauty oils deliver nutrients more effectively to supply intense nourishment. Oils like rosehip oil, packed with essential fatty acids, improve skin elasticity. For those with oily skin, non-comedogenic options like jojoba help balance. Dry or mature skin types see the most results with nutrient-dense oils including marula, which restore moisture. Using a nourishing oil into your skincare practice ensures a radiant glow, leading to soft, healthy-looking skin.
